STORAGE Keep siding clean and dry at all times. Inspect prior to application.

Do not store CanExel Siding in heated buildings. Storage in Allow siding to adjust to atmospheric conditions before
heated buildings will dry out the siding and make it susceptible application.
to buckling.

The siding must be kept on Maibec CanExel supplied pallets or
at least 152 mm (6 in) from the ground, must remain flat and
must be covered with a water resistant shroud provided by
Maibec CanExel.

PRIMARY WEATHER RESISTANT BARRIER

A properly installed breathable water-resistive barrier (Tyvek®, Typar, etc.) is required behind the siding. Special care must be taken
to completely seal all openings for electrical boxes, conduits, pipes, wiring, and joints or tears in the water-resistive barrier to prevent
moisture from entering the wall cavity.

Consult your local building code for details. Maibec CanExel will assume no responsibility for water penetration.

GAPS & SEALANTS

Seal all gaps with a high quality, non-hardening, paintable sealant. Follow the sealant manufacturer’s instructions for application
and maintenance.

FURRING STRIPS (STRAPPING) - Where required with building code

See detailed installation Instructions (See Page 6). Furring strip use will vary with the various orientations of the siding (horizontal,
vertical or diagonal). New 25 mm x 76 mm (1 in. x 3 in.) kiln-dried furring strips, straight and undamaged (no rot, not splits), must be
used for a new building. For renovation, see below best practice.

RE-SIDING OF EXISTING BUILDINGS

The new siding MUST be installed on new furring strips (strapping), straight and undamaged after the water resistive barrier is replaced.
For renovation it is best practice to replace all existing furring strips and water resistive barrier with new compliant elements. The old
siding must be removed.

TRIM

Trim should be thick enough so the siding does not extend beyond the face of the trim.
Trim and fascia must be applied in a manner that will not allow moisture intrusion or water buildup.

5. TWO STORY OR MORE WALLS (NEW CONSTRUCTION ONLY)

Where siding is applied vertically or diagonally on walls two stories or more, cut the siding at each floor line leaving a 5 mm (3/16 in.) gap
between the bottom and top pieces. Finish the gap by sealing the gap with a high quality paintable non-hardening sealant. If a horizontal
band or trim separates the siding between floors, install a Z flashing and seal the end of the siding with the Canexel touch up paint.

If the siding is installed vertically on a wall that exceeds 3 m (approx. 10') in height, the code’s fire safety requirements may require a
fire-blocking barrier.

6. CORNER TREATMENT

Siding should be butted to inside and outside corners leaving a 5 mm (3/16 in.) gap. When CanExel aluminum inside and outside corners
are used they should be installed BEFORE the siding; if not, wood trim may be applied over the siding after its installation. (See Figures
5G-5H).

7. TOUCH-UPS

Color-matched touch-up paint can be used to repair small scratches and chips that may occur during installation. Dab the touch-up with a
Q-tip or point of a cloth to soak in to the raw surface, do not brush or rub.

CARE OF CANEXEL PREFINISHED SIDING

All Canexel Siding finishes are long wearing and require For further product information in the US and Canada,
little maintenance. For best results, siding must be washed please call 1 800 363-1930 or write to: Maibec CanExelTM,
annually using non-abrasive household cleaners according 202 - 1984, 5e Rue, Lévis, Québec G6W 5M6, Canada.
to the manufacturer’s recommendations. Test cleaners on a
small area to ensure they do not damage the finish. Rinse
siding surface thoroughly after cleaning. DO NOT USE
PRESSURE WASHER.
